Solution
To make your statement more effective at meeting the requirements of identifying the specific problem and considering key stakeholders, you can consider the following steps:
-
Clearly define the problem: Ensure that your statement clearly identifies the specific problem you are trying to solve. Avoid vague or general statements and instead focus on a specific issue or challenge that needs to be addressed.
-
Be specific and concise: Make sure your statement is specific and concise, avoiding any unnecessary details or jargon. This will help to clearly communicate the problem at hand and make it easier for stakeholders to understand.
-
Consider the perspective of key stakeholders: Take into account the perspectives and interests of key stakeholders who are directly or indirectly affected by the problem. This will help to ensure that your statement acknowledges their concerns and priorities.
-
Use language that is accessible to all stakeholders: Avoid using technical or industry-specific language that may be difficult for some stakeholders to understand. Instead, use clear and simple language that can be easily comprehended by all parties involved.
By following these steps, you can enhance the effectiveness of your statement in addressing the specific problem and considering the needs of key stakeholders.
